Strive disclosed in an 8-K filing with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ission that it bought 20 Bitcoin between July 27 and July 31, 2026, at an average price of about $63,191 per coin. After the purchase, the company’s total Bitcoin holdings stood at 20,020 BTC as of July 31. The filing also showed that Strive held 505,000 shares of Strategy STRC preferred stock with a fair value of about $45.18 million, along with roughly $151.3 million in cash. The update provides a snapshot of the company’s balance sheet at the end of the reporting period, covering its Bitcoin position, equity holdings and cash reserves.
